Clasp mechanism to enable concealment and use by those with limited dexterity
A clasp mechanism is disclosed. Example embodiments are directed to a clasp mechanism comprising: an outer tube; an end cap attached at a top of the outer tube; an inner tube encompassed by the outer tube, the inner tube having a beveled edge at the top; a spring and a plate captured between the end cap and the beveled edge of the inner tube; a slotted end-cap at the bottom of the outer tube; and a hook configured for insertion into a slot of the slotted end-cap, to latch to the beveled edge of the inner tube, and to be held in place by the spring and plate.

Watch case comprising removable horns
Watch case including: a middle; at least one pair of horns intended to retain a wristwatch strap portion; the middle including a first lock member; and a second lock member mounted on the pair of horns and complementary to the first member to lock the pair of horns to the middle. The case also includes a manipulation member that can be manipulated by a user in order to move the second member between a locking position in which the members co-operate to maintain the pair of horns on the middle and a release position in which the pair of horns can be detached from the middle.

DETACHABLE SYSTEM AND APPARATUS FOR REMOVABLE JEWELRY COMPONENTS AND CLASPS
The invention is a releasable locking apparatus to be adapted to a piece of jewelry where one or more of its components are meant to be removable and replaced with another, for example, a decorative end cap. The apparatus consisting of two parts, a female and a male member, where one of the members is detachable. In a simple push and twist, the system unlocks and locks the one part of a clasp or component, securing it into place through compression and barrier walls. The apparatus can be adapted to a variety of different designs of clasp or end cap and facilitates the way a charm may be placed in a chain or cord bracelet or necklace. The apparatus can also be adapted to any design component intended to be substituted with another one.
Wearable device
A wearable device includes a device main body and a connection structure. The device main body includes a snap portion configured to snap with the connection structure. The connection structure includes a main body, a fastening assembly, and a pressing member. The main body defines a fastening groove. The fastening assembly is rotationally mounted within the fastening groove. The fastening assembly includes a first end portion and a second end portion. The fastening assembly includes a latching portion protruding from the first end portion. The latching portion is configured to snap with the snap portion. The pressing member is arranged on the second end portion of the fastening assembly. When the second end portion is pressed, the first end portion is rotated away from the snap portion to disengage the latching portion from the snap portion.

Removable bracelet for horology or jewellry
A removable bracelet for horology or jewellery, with a bracelet portion arranged to confine a watch or jewellery bar, including, at the end thereof a chamber arranged for housing the bar, the chamber including a lateral opening on a first side of the bracelet portion for the insertion or removal of the bar, the bracelet portion including a pusher controlling a tongue movable in a longitudinal direction against a spring, the pusher is movable in a transverse direction and includes a first profile arranged to cooperate with a second profile of the tongue to transform the transverse motion of the pusher into a longitudinal motion of the tongue, the bracelet includes a closure arranged on the first side for retaining the pusher in the depth of the bracelet portion.
